Off shore? Be sure!

Globalisation of the world economy has brought significant opportunities and threats to UK manufacturing. The key issue for UK manufacturers is competitiveness - offshore activities provide many opportunities to gain an edge in this area, be it exporting, licensing of intellectual property or just simply lower-cost procurement. MAS West Midlands has developed an 'Offshoring' exercise to raise your awareness of the issues and complexities of this, frequently emotive, subject. Torch Factory Simulation

The Manufacturing Advisory Service (MAS) is running a series of interactive manufacturing simulations at its stand at MACH 2008. The aim of the Torch Factory Simulation is simple - teams must assemble as many torches as possible over a given time. Torches that light up and meet the customer's expectations are counted as a profit.

Assigning specific roles and responsibilities to individuals, the teams have three years of hypothetical manufacturing production in which to establish the most effective processes, identify any areas of waste, and implement improvements to enhance the performance of their factory.

The team that makes the most profit after the three-year production period is the winner and will be automatically entered onto the event's Top Gear-style scoreboard. Along with a daily prize for the winning team, when MACH draws to a close, the team with the overall best profit score of the week will be rewarded.
